DNA Concrete Pumping specialises in reaching pour sites that standard mixer trucks simply can't access. Their line pump equipment handles steep blocks, tight driveways, backyards with no vehicle access, and construction sites with limited entry points. We've heard from local builders that the crew has tackled residential slabs on difficult terrain and commercial pours where traditional concrete delivery wasn't an option — they get concrete exactly where it needs to go.
